Berlin summons Russian ambassador Sergei Nechaev to denounce Russia's threats against Germany due to the support provided to Ukraine.

The German Foreign Ministry announced on Monday the summoning of Russian Ambassador Sergei Nechaev, in response to direct threats from Russia against certain targets in Germany, in the context of German support for Ukraine. German officials emphasized that they will not be intimidated by these threats and espionage activities, considering them unacceptable. Details about the nature of the threats and the targeted sites were not provided.


The summoning of the ambassador comes after the Russian Foreign Ministry published a list of German companies involved in the manufacturing of drones for Ukraine. Also, on the same day, Russian security services announced the arrest of a German woman, accused of transporting a homemade device intended for a planned attack by Ukraine. The German government, the main donor to Ukraine, remains on alert due to a campaign of espionage and cyberattacks attributed to Moscow.
